ACCIDENTS NEWS
- ➤ Colleagues remembered Chief Meteorologist Roland Steadham, who died Tuesday morning in a small plane crash on the Payette River near Emmett, as they shared memories with CBS2. KBOI
CULTURE NEWS
- ➤ Boise officials designated Betty the Washerwoman as a historic landmark on Vista Avenue to honor a cherished local icon (residents often recall her familiar presence). Idaho Press
EDUCATION NEWS
- ➤ West Ada School District officials David Reinhart and Miranda Carson presented a school boundary rezoning proposal to the board on Jan. 12. The district now plans to review the changes to address longstanding zoning challenges. Idaho Press
GOVERNMENT NEWS
- ➤ Boise Fire Department is training at the Outlet Mall, which is set for demolition, this week to practice structure and airport fire response. The exercise helps ensure first responders are ready for emergencies. KIDO
- ➤ Idaho holds unclaimed money for residents on its official property site (yourmoney.idaho.gov). Residents who have moved or changed banks can search for old paychecks and bank accounts and follow secure prompts to claim funds by providing the required documentation. KIDO
HEALTH NEWS
- ➤ Idaho shoppers can still purchase foods containing Red Dye No. 3 until the FDA ban takes effect on Jan. 15, 2027 (some brands have updated their products while others continue offering the ingredient). KIDO
SPORTS NEWS
- ➤ Demarcus Lawrence, a Boise State alum and five-time Pro Bowler with the Seattle Seahawks, will forgo the 2026 Pro Bowl as he is set to play in the Super Bowl. The Pro Bowl is scheduled for Tuesday, Feb. 3 in San Francisco. KIDO
- ➤ The Professional Bull Riders will perform their Pendleton Whisky Velocity Tour at the Ford Idaho Center in Nampa Friday and Saturday. Fans can expect a raucous event with thrilling rides as the tour returns for a weekend of local excitement. Idaho Press
- ➤ Idaho football fans will watch Boise State’s Demarcus Lawrence and George Holani play for the Seattle Seahawks in the Super Bowl on Sunday, while University of Idaho’s Christian Ellis competes for the opposing team — a vivid display of the state’s fierce football tradition. KIDO
- ➤ Boise’s curling club will host learn-to-curl sessions at Idaho Ice World starting Feb. 1 through March for $40 each that include off-ice basics, on-ice instruction and a mini-game, and participants should come in warm, flexible clothes and athletic shoes. KIDO
